Your new role
As our new Senior Financial accountant, you will be part of Central European Finance & Administration team. Our team is vibrant, innovative, international and supportive. You will be managing a CE organisation, such as Italy, Spain, Belgium, Netherland, Portugal or any other new countries in Europe as we expand, you will support the team abroad and collaborate with colleagues from different countries.
Your key responsibilities will be:
1. Ensure compliance with relevant accounting standards and regulations
2. Be responsible for monthly and yearly closure of books of accounts as per Group calendar and deadlines
3. Prepare and submit all required tax filings and ensure compliance with all tax laws (including VAT, WHT and statistical reports, among others)…
4. Support the annual audit process and liaise with external auditors
5. Ensure compliance to internal Group policies relating to finance functions and fulfil internal requirement such as Cash forecast
6. Coordinate Finance Shares Service Centre in India, supporting queries, having regular dialogue, finding opportunities improvement, managing the performance of relevant teams through feedback and analysis if processes and with other key functions in Ramboll – Group Treasury, Group Tax, transformation team, Group Audit etc
7. Manage non standard F&A transactions
8. Represent F&A in integration process of new acquired company with presence in Italy, Spain, Belgium, Netherland, Portugal
9. Integrate and harmonize financial systems (ERP, accounting software) across the acquired entities, ensuring smooth data flow and reporting
10. Ensure clear communication with key stakeholders
11. Ensure the successful implementation of new software or tools in compliance with local regulations
